Air Fryer Onion Rings (Homemade)

Air Fryer Onion Rings (Homemade): 7 Crispy Joys Await

Crispy and delicious homemade onion rings made in an air fryer.

  • Total Time: 27 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 large onion, sliced into rings
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 eggs, beaten
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Cooking spray

Instructions

  1. Preheat your air fryer to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Slice the onion into rings.
  3. In a bowl, mix flour,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.
  4. Dip each onion ring into the flour mixture, then into the beaten eggs, and finally coat with breadcrumbs.
  5. Spray the air fryer basket with cooking spray.
  6. Place the onion rings in a single layer in the basket.
  7. Cook for 10-12 minutes until golden brown, flipping halfway through.
  8. Remove and let cool before serving.

Notes

  • Adjust seasoning as per your taste.
  • For extra flavor, add parmesan to the breadcrumb mixture.
  • Make sure onion rings do not overlap in the air fryer.
